House Prices .io

Instant prices paid data for England and Wales

Latest house prices for Townmead Road, London

Details of 458 sales available for this area

Date Price Address
15/06/2007 Details... £303,000 Flat 20, Spackman House, 12, Townmead Road, London, SW6 2NZ Details...
12/06/2007 Details... £303,000 Flat 19, Dwyer House, 2, Townmead Road, London, SW6 2NZ Details...
12/06/2007 Details... £303,000 Flat 3, Dwyer House, 2, Townmead Road, London, SW6 2NZ Details...
11/06/2007 Details... £303,000 Flat 11, Dwyer House, 2, Townmead Road, London, SW6 2NZ Details...
08/06/2007 Details... £303,000 Flat 15, Dwyer House, 2, Townmead Road, London, SW6 2NZ Details...
25/05/2007 Details... £360,000 Ground Floor Flat, 50 Townmead Road, London, SW6 2RR Details...
04/05/2007 Details... £392,000 148 Townmead Road, London, SW6 2RH Details...
04/04/2007 Details... £360,000 Ground Floor Flat, 48 Townmead Road, London, SW6 2RR Details...
19/01/2007 Details... £237,965 Flat 37, Nacovia House, Townmead Road, London, SW6 2GW Details...
09/01/2007 Details... £325,000 106a Townmead Road, London, SW6 2SG Details...
14/12/2006 Details... £262,465 Flat 7, Nacovia House, Townmead Road, London, SW6 2GW Details...
13/12/2006 Details... £248,465 Flat 32, Nacovia House, Townmead Road, London, SW6 2GW Details...
13/12/2006 Details... £283,465 Flat 36, Nacovia House, Townmead Road, London, SW6 2GW Details...
08/12/2006 Details... £241,465 Flat 30, Nacovia House, Townmead Road, London, SW6 2GW Details...
07/12/2006 Details... £209,965 Flat 31, Nacovia House, Townmead Road, London, SW6 2GW Details...
04/12/2006 Details... £237,965 Flat 22, Nacovia House, Townmead Road, London, SW6 2GW Details...
27/11/2006 Details... £234,465 Flat 24, Nacovia House, Townmead Road, London, SW6 2GW Details...
27/11/2006 Details... £248,465 Flat 23, Nacovia House, Townmead Road, London, SW6 2GW Details...
13/11/2006 Details... £220,465 Flat 10, Nacovia House, Townmead Road, London, SW6 2GW Details...
13/11/2006 Details... £234,465 Flat 9, Nacovia House, Townmead Road, London, SW6 2GW Details...